Our farm is family owned and run. Our family is dedicated to providing education and healthy products to your family. We want our kids and yours to understand the value of sustainable environment and experience how fun that can be! I visited with my two children who are 9 and 10 years old and we had a lot of fun learning about the ostriches, feeding them, and visiting the other animals on the farm. Our visit was from noon until 2 PM and a lot was packed into that two hours but we didn’t feel rushed. If you visit, bring some extra cash to buy some of the ostrich meat, dishes or cosmetics made from ostrich oil. There are also soft drinks and ice cream for sale.

Our experience here was AMAZING!! What sets this tour apart from others is how much the owner truly loves raising her ostriches and how knowledgeable she is about them. Our family was pleasantly surprised by how many interesting facts we learnt about the ostriches, and how fun the tour was all around. There are many other animals you will meat on the tour as well - including exotic chickens, alpacas, bunnies, kittens, and you'll get a chance to actually feed the ostriches as well. There aren't a lot of tours out there that can engage toddlers, children, teens, and adults alike, but truly, I think this farm has mastered it. At the end of the tour, you will have the option of trying various food with ostrich-meat. We highly recommend the ostrich cheboreki! Yelena told us people drive to her farm especially for them, and we're not surprised! Exceptionally crispy and high-quality.
